How Do the PNB SIP Investment Plan Works?
You can learn the working of a PNB SIP Plan from the following illustration:
For Example, if you start investing in a PNB SIP Plan as per the following details, your maturity amount using a SIP Calculator can be calculated as follows:
- Monthly SIP Amount: ₹5,000
- Investment Period: 10 years (120 months)
- Expected Annual Return: 12% (equity-oriented SIP)
PNB SIP Calculator Results:
- Total Investment: ₹6,00,000
- Estimated Corpus: ₹11.2 lakh
- Wealth Gained: ₹5.2 lakh
How to Choose the Right SIP Plan with PNB?
Choosing the right SIP investment plan with PNB involves considering several factors:
- Investment Objective: Define your investment objective, whether it is long-term wealth creation, retirement planning, or meeting short-term financial goals. Align your investment plan accordingly.
- Risk Tolerance: Determine your risk tolerance. If you have a higher risk appetite and are willing to withstand market volatility, you may opt for equity-oriented SIP plans. For a conservative approach, debt or balanced funds may be more suitable.
- Fund Performance: Evaluate the historical performance of the funds offered by PNB. Consider factors such as consistent returns, the fund manager's track record, and risk-adjusted returns.
- Expense Ratio: Pay attention to the expense ratio, which represents the annual charges deducted by the fund for managing the investments. Lower expense ratios can have a positive impact on overall returns.
